We’re looking for a friendly, detail-oriented, Chinese speaking professional to be the welcoming face of our primary care clinic. As a Front Desk Coordinator, you’ll play a vital role in creating a smooth and positive experience for our patients—from the moment they walk in, to managing their appointments and supporting the care team. If you thrive in a fast-paced environment, love helping others, and are passionate about making a difference in a healthcare setting, we’d love to meet you!
- As a Floater, you will be working at multiple locations based on business operations.

Greet people entering the office, answering questions, providing directions and instructions on the check-in procedureManage a multiple-line phone system by addressing caller concerns, routing callers to the appropriate extensions, and leaving messages for the healthcare providersProvide basic and accurate information in-person and via telephone / emailMaintain the reception area, keeping it clean and free of clutter.Handle filing and data entry as requestedMaintain office security by following safety procedures and controlling access via the reception deskMust be detail oriented and possess strong organizational skills in a fast-pace environmentGood verbal and written communication skillsBe able to prioritize workload while remaining flexibleMay be required to work overtime to meet tight deadlinesHighly motivated and able to work with multiple teams simultaneouslyTake telephone messages and provide feedback and answers to patient / physician / pharmacy callsPerform other clerical duties such as filing, photocopying, transcribing and faxingOther duties as requiredQualifications
MUST BE fluent in Chinese (Cantonese / Mandarin)Minimum 1 year of experience working at the front desk of a hospital or clinicStrong communication skills; comfortable interacting with patients, staff, and providersProficient in handling phone calls, messages, and front desk coordinationYou're great for the role if :
Work experience at the Front Desk of an outpatient primary care or specialty clinicExperience using electronic health record (EHR) systems for scheduling and patient updatesFamiliar with HIPAA regulations and maintaining patient confidentialityEnvironmental Job Requirements and Working Conditions
The total pay range for this role is $20 - $24 per hour. This salary range represents our national target range for this role.This role follows a onsite work structure where the expectation is to work onsite 5 days a week.
